I believe it's when you're talking to Ser Bryant.  You can keep bugging him for news, and he says something like "Not unless you care to hear about the mages" and you can tell him you were going to ask them for help.  He'll tell you then about the Rite of Annullment being called for and what not, and Alsitair gives you the line in the picture.

"The Sworn Sword" is in a different volume called Legends II.  According to Wikipedia there is a new one out called "The Mystery Knight."  Oh and I have to correct myself, SoIaF is not based on "The Hedge Knight."  The series was well under way when he wrote it after having been asked for a submission of a short story.  He wrote it as a prequel so as not to give away any SoIaF spoilers.
